Xcode for Windows: What & Why

Xcode contains everything you need to build iOS apps, and it only runs on macOS!

That’s when the problems start. You want to make an iOS app with your Windows PC, but you can’t buy a PC or laptop with macOS pre-installed on it. Unlike Windows, Apple doesn’t license its operating system to other computer manufacturers. You can only use macOS on a Mac.

In fact, when you obtain a license to use macOS, which happens when you purchase a Mac computer, you have to agree to only run the operating system on Apple hardware. This effectively limits you to only develop apps on a Mac.

Rent a Mac in the Cloud

An even easier way to get your hands on macOS, albeit more expensive, is to rent a Mac “in the Cloud”. You can work with Xcode on Windows with this approach, because you’re essentially connected to a Mac that’s elsewhere.

Here’s how that works:

  • Someone connects a bunch of Mac’s to the internet
  • You sign in on one of those Macs via a Remote Desktop Connection (RDP)
  • Done! You can use this Mac from Windows/Linux and build iOS apps

Services like MacinCloud and MacStadium offer affordable rent-a-Mac products, usually paid on a monthly basis. Prices typically start at $20/month and you can choose from several hardware options, including Mac Mini and Mac Pro.

You connect to those cloud-based Macs via a Remote Desktop Connection (RDP). Windows includes a stock Remote Desktop Client you can use, and so do most Linux operating systems. Once you’re logged on, you can launch Xcode, and start building your iOS app. That way you’re effectively running Xcode on your Windows PC!

Cloud-based Macs usually come in 3 flavours:

  • A dedicated Mac, which means you get access to a physical Mac located in a data center, as if you bought a Mac in the Apple Store and put it on your desk.
  • A virtual Mac, which means you get access to a virtual Mac in a data center, much like the VirtualBox solution mentioned earlier. Your Mac won’t run on Apple hardware, but it will run macOS.
  • A Mac Build Server, which is a specialized kind of Mac that can be used to compile iOS apps. You’ll create those apps on your Mac, and then instruct the Build Server to compile the app for you.

A dedicated Mac is the most convenient, and the most powerful option. A virtual Mac is OK too, but it typically does not perform as well as a physical Mac computer.

Running Xcode via a Mac in the cloud has a drawback: you can’t easily connect your iPhone to Xcode via USB! With Xcode on your local Mac you can run and debug your app on your own iPhone, via the USB/Lightning cable. This obviously won’t work when your Mac is in the cloud…

Don’t worry! There are plenty of solutions for that:

  • A simple approach is to run your app on iPhone Simulator, right from within Xcode. You can launch iPhone Simulator in Xcode, and debug your app with it. This is perfect for the development phase of your project.
  • An alternative solution are tools like Flexihub, NoMachine and USB Network Gate. They only work with dedicated Mac hardware, and you need to have a dedicated IP address.
  • Install your iOS app on your iPhone via TestFlight, and debug it with a tool like Bugsnag. You can monitor and debug live crashes in your app.

Although Microsoft’s mobile aspirations were all for nothing (sorry, Windows Phone fans), Microsoft’s still dominant on the desktop. Moreover, its ambitious universal approach to development means apps you create potentially have reach across a wide range of platforms.

01. Windows Dev Center

Microsoft’s Windows Dev Center is the natural starting point for anyone keen to make windows apps – for PCs, tablets, phones, and more. There are explainers about Universal Windows Platform (UWP) app development, insight into Windows conventions, and a bunch of code examples.

02. Create your first Windows app

If you want to quickly get something working, this tutorial from Microsoft walks you through how to create a simple ‘Hello, world’ app for UWP using XAML and C#. Also, rather than just fling up a dialog to say hello, this little app will speak.

03. Create a Windows desktop app with C#

This 15-minute video tutorial walks through how to create a desktop app for Windows using C# and Visual Studio. It comes from the Computer Science YouTube channel. You’ll end up with a simple popup with two different response options.

04. Make a Windows clock app

This tutorial for Tuts+ goes a bit further than many beginners’ guides. Vivek Maskara leads you through the process of making a clock, where the background gradually shifts colour by converting the time to a hexadecimal value.

05. Create a simple UWP game with DirectX

Sadly, this tutorial from Microsoft doesn’t leave you with a playable game at the end. Still, you do at least learn to work on the major components of a game: creating a game loop, rendering, controls, audio, and adding imagery.

You will always require a MacOSX environment. You could look at hosted MacOSX solutions or connecting to a virtual session but eventually you will need a Mac. Having said that, you can actually create code within any editor of your choice. However, you are not going to be able to easily debug the code, and you will need a MacOSX environment to submit any project to the App Store.

Note that when choosing a machine you should get one that can support the latest OSX version if possible.

While there are ways to pseudo-code up to a point, Apple’s IDE requires macOS if you expect to build and upload to the store.

You can use VMware which allows you to install any OS, you don’t need to by a Mac. However, if you were thinking to use win 10 for developing iOS , you can not.

You can’t run a MacOS VM on a Windows machine. But you can do the reverse, so if you can only buy one machine, buy a Mac and use Windows VMs 🙂

Top 8 Ways to Develop an iOS App on Windows PC

1. Use Virtualbox and Install Mac OS on Your Windows PC

The quickest way to develop iOS apps on windows is with the help of a virtual machine.

A virtual machine will create an environment where any operating system can run in like it’s running in the same hardware itself.

This functionality is called virtualization as it allows you to run Windows on Linux and even Windows on OS X.

To run Mac OS on a virtual machine, you need two things:

• A copy of OS X as a virtual image file or an installer.

• A virtual machine tool like VirtualBox or VMWare.

You can acquire a duplicate of OS X by downloading it from the App Store.

You can likewise find installers from different sources on the internet.

Remember that utilizing Mac OS on non-Apple hardware is against Apple’s End User License Agreement (EULA).

2. Rent a Mac in the Cloud

A considerably simpler approach to get your hands on OS X is to lease a Mac in the Cloud, although it will be much more expensive.

Services like Mac-in-Cloud and Mac-Stadium offer affordable rent-a-Mac products.

You can connect with those cloud-based Macs by means of a Remote Desktop Connection (RDP).

Windows provides a stock Remote Desktop you can utilize, thus do most Linux OS.

Once you’re signed in, you can install Xcode and your iOS app development services.

6. Use Unity3D

A powerful IDE, Unity, is essentially known as a game development engine that can be used on Android, iOS, Windows, and many other platforms.

But its rapid development and powerful features also make it a good choice for building non-gaming apps.

Unity’s “Cloud Build” feature supports iOS development on Windows in simple steps.

By registering as an Apple developer and joining the unity cloud build, it is easy to set up, create, and build iOS projects.

With a free to use editor for development and distribution, it is possible to completely build an ios app in Windows.

You only need a Mac to compile the project!

7. With the Hybrid Framework, Xamarin

A cheaper option than Cloud Mac, hybrid frameworks give a cost-effective solution or iOS development on Windows.

Xamarin is a trusted choice by most developers, who claim that it provides real native output.

It uses C# for coding. It is a feature-rich platform that allows you to build and compile iOS apps and deploy them to iOS devices from Windows.

The only thing you cannot do from Windows and require a Mac is the submission to the app store.

8. In React Native Environment

React Native is a cross platform tool based on Javascript that is widely being used for iOS development on Windows.

It has several exceptional features and an easy learning curve, making it a popular tool among developers.

Using the android emulator and by setting up Mac OS deployment machines, developing an iOS application in Windows is possible.

To see the output, you can use the Expo simulator, which is available on both Android and iOS.
